// Code generated by MockGen. DO NOT EDIT.
// Source: pkg/service/fabric/service.go
// Package fabric is a generated GoMock package.
package fabric
import (
context "context"
reflect "reflect"
gomock "github.com/golang/mock/gomock"
fabric "github.com/kleister/kleister-api/pkg/internal/fabric"
model "github.com/kleister/kleister-api/pkg/model"
)
// MockService is a mock of Service interface.
type MockService struct {
ctrl *gomock.Controller
recorder *MockServiceMockRecorder
}
// MockServiceMockRecorder is the mock recorder for MockService.
type MockServiceMockRecorder struct {
mock *MockService
}
// NewMockService creates a new mock instance.
func NewMockService(ctrl *gomock.Controller) *MockService {
mock := &MockService{ctrl: ctrl}
mock.recorder = &MockServiceMockRecorder{mock}
return mock
}
// EXPECT returns an object that allows the caller to indicate expected use.
func (m *MockService) EXPECT() *MockServiceMockRecorder {
return m.recorder
}
// AttachBuild mocks base method.
func (m *MockService) AttachBuild(arg0 context.Context, arg1 model.FabricBuildParams) error {
m.ctrl.T.Helper()
ret := m.ctrl.Call(m, "AttachBuild", arg0, arg1)
ret0, _ := ret[0].(error)
return ret0
}
// AttachBuild indicates an expected call of AttachBuild.
func (mr *MockServiceMockRecorder) AttachBuild(arg0, arg1 interface{}) *gomock.Call {
mr.mock.ctrl.T.Helper()
return mr.mock.ctrl.RecordCallWithMethodType(mr.mock, "AttachBuild", reflect.TypeOf((*MockService)(nil).AttachBuild), arg0, arg1)
}
// DropBuild mocks base method.
func (m *MockService) DropBuild(arg0 context.Context, arg1 model.FabricBuildParams) error {
m.ctrl.T.Helper()
ret := m.ctrl.Call(m, "DropBuild", arg0, arg1)
ret0, _ := ret[0].(error)
return ret0
}
// DropBuild indicates an expected call of DropBuild.
func (mr *MockServiceMockRecorder) DropBuild(arg0, arg1 interface{}) *gomock.Call {
mr.mock.ctrl.T.Helper()
return mr.mock.ctrl.RecordCallWithMethodType(mr.mock, "DropBuild", reflect.TypeOf((*MockService)(nil).DropBuild), arg0, arg1)
}
// List mocks base method.
func (m *MockService) List(arg0 context.Context, arg1 model.ListParams) ([]*model.Fabric, int64, error) {
m.ctrl.T.Helper()
ret := m.ctrl.Call(m, "List", arg0, arg1)
ret0, _ := ret[0].([]*model.Fabric)
ret1, _ := ret[1].(int64)
ret2, _ := ret[2].(error)
return ret0, ret1, ret2
}
// List indicates an expected call of List.
func (mr *MockServiceMockRecorder) List(arg0, arg1 interface{}) *gomock.Call {
mr.mock.ctrl.T.Helper()
return mr.mock.ctrl.RecordCallWithMethodType(mr.mock, "List", reflect.TypeOf((*MockService)(nil).List), arg0, arg1)
}
// ListBuilds mocks base method.
func (m *MockService) ListBuilds(arg0 context.Context, arg1 model.FabricBuildParams) ([]*model.Build, int64, error) {
m.ctrl.T.Helper()
ret := m.ctrl.Call(m, "ListBuilds", arg0, arg1)
ret0, _ := ret[0].([]*model.Build)
ret1, _ := ret[1].(int64)
ret2, _ := ret[2].(error)
return ret0, ret1, ret2
}
// ListBuilds indicates an expected call of ListBuilds.
func (mr *MockServiceMockRecorder) ListBuilds(arg0, arg1 interface{}) *gomock.Call {
mr.mock.ctrl.T.Helper()
return mr.mock.ctrl.RecordCallWithMethodType(mr.mock, "ListBuilds", reflect.TypeOf((*MockService)(nil).ListBuilds), arg0, arg1)
}
// Show mocks base method.
func (m *MockService) Show(arg0 context.Context, arg1 string) (*model.Fabric, error) {
m.ctrl.T.Helper()
ret := m.ctrl.Call(m, "Show", arg0, arg1)
ret0, _ := ret[0].(*model.Fabric)
ret1, _ := ret[1].(error)
return ret0, ret1
}
// Show indicates an expected call of Show.
func (mr *MockServiceMockRecorder) Show(arg0, arg1 interface{}) *gomock.Call {
mr.mock.ctrl.T.Helper()
return mr.mock.ctrl.RecordCallWithMethodType(mr.mock, "Show", reflect.TypeOf((*MockService)(nil).Show), arg0, arg1)
}
// Sync mocks base method.
func (m *MockService) Sync(arg0 context.Context, arg1 fabric.Versions) error {
m.ctrl.T.Helper()
ret := m.ctrl.Call(m, "Sync", arg0, arg1)
ret0, _ := ret[0].(error)
return ret0
}
// Sync indicates an expected call of Sync.
func (mr *MockServiceMockRecorder) Sync(arg0, arg1 interface{}) *gomock.Call {
mr.mock.ctrl.T.Helper()
return mr.mock.ctrl.RecordCallWithMethodType(mr.mock, "Sync", reflect.TypeOf((*MockService)(nil).Sync), arg0, arg1)
}
// WithPrincipal mocks base method.
func (m *MockService) WithPrincipal(arg0 *model.User) Service {
m.ctrl.T.Helper()
ret := m.ctrl.Call(m, "WithPrincipal", arg0)
ret0, _ := ret[0].(Service)
return ret0
}
// WithPrincipal indicates an expected call of WithPrincipal.
func (mr *MockServiceMockRecorder) WithPrincipal(arg0 interface{}) *gomock.Call {
mr.mock.ctrl.T.Helper()
return mr.mock.ctrl.RecordCallWithMethodType(mr.mock, "WithPrincipal", reflect.TypeOf((*MockService)(nil).WithPrincipal), arg0)
}
